Bones Found Could Be Missing 3-Year-Old's
Analyce Guerra Disappeared In 2006

MURFREESBORO, Tenn. -- Police sources told Channel 4 News on Friday that bones found a week ago are likely those of Anaylce Guerra.
Video: Remains Found Could Be Missing 3-Year-Old'sThe information gained by Channel 4 came from four different law enforcement sources who all said that investigators believe it is likely the bones are those of Guerra.“There's not one day that I don't pray for her; just bring her home, no matter when,” said Analyce’s mother, Eva Guerra. “Sometimes I feel I've passed her."In an interview with Channel 4 a few weeks ago, Guerra's mother said she thinks her daughter is still alive.“I still think she's here. I still think she's here in Smyrna,” Guerra said.Last Friday, some walkers found a human skull near the Stones River Battlefield in Murfreesboro. The next morning, after combing the scene, investigators found more bones.While no official conclusions have been made, sources told Channel 4 that Analyce Guerra is at the center of their probe.Analyce Guerra was last seen on April 23, 2006. Her mother said she disappeared while the family was sleeping.Police searched the apartment complex where Guerra lived and also drained a nearby creek, but nothing was found that could lead them to Analyce.An anthropologist is also helping investigators with the identification process.Channel 4 spoke briefly with Analyce's grandmother on Friday, and she said the family is still hopeful and that she feels God has Analyce safe.Of all of the Amber Alerts issued by the Tennessee Bureau of Investigation to find missing children, Analyce is the only person who hasn't yet been located.
